Electric Warp Beam Trolley: The "First Cornerstone" in Automation Layout
In traditional textile production, the handling of heavy items like warp beams, weft beams, and fabric rolls heavily relies on manual labor, leading to several issues:
Low handling efficiency, creating bottlenecks on the production line;
Frequent human errors, reducing machine uptime;
High labor turnover and costly staff training;
Increased risk of workplace injuries due to frequent human-machine interactions.
The introduction of electric warp beam trolleys effectively addresses these challenges. It enables:
Efficient single-operator handling with precise machine docking;
Reduced manual intervention, raising the level of operational standardization;
Guaranteed production continuity, increasing overall machine uptime;
A solid foundation for future production data collection and smart scheduling.
In short, the electric warp beam trolley is a critical first step toward smart factory transformation in textile mills, carrying significant strategic value.
Boosting Production Efficiency and Unlocking Greater Capacity
Equipped with an electric drive system, stepless speed control, and an EPS electronic steering system, electric warp beam trolleys excel in handling heavy loads with precision. Key advantages include:
50%-70% reduction in beam loading time;
Over 90% reduction in handling errors;
Shorter machine downtime, faster production cycles;
10%-15% increase in workshop output with the same scale.
In the textile industry where "time is money," saving even 10 minutes per day on beam changes accumulates into a substantial competitive edge over the course of a year.
